Jersey listed buildings & places

Every entry on the Government of Jersey's Historic Environment Record — buildings and places protected under the Planning and Building (Jersey) Law 2002. 4,265 entries on file · showing 4,265 matching.

Why this matters if you're buying

A listed building or place is a real legal constraint, not just a heritage label: altering, extending or demolishing one typically needs Listed Building Consent from the States of Jersey, on top of ordinary planning permission — and that can materially change what a buyer can actually do with a property.
